The Rachael Ray Cucina Nonstick Bakeware Set is a comprehensive 10-piece collection designed for both novice and experienced bakers. Made from heavy gauge steel, this set features colorful, ergonomic handles and a durable nonstick coating for effortless food release and cleanup. With a variety of essential bakeware shapes, including cookie sheets, cake pans, and muffin trays, this set is oven safe up to 450°F, making it perfect for all your baking adventures.

High Quality Bakeware
I researched reviews of bakeware before making my purchase. I am really impressed with the quality of the Rachael Ray set. It is attractive, easy to clean, and sturdy. I like the depth of the baking sheets, and the nice extras like the muffin pan cover, and loaf pan insert. I have bought other, cheaper sets that warped, scratched easily and quickly got rusty - essentially I got what I paid for. Though the Rachael Ray set was a bigger investment, I can tell that with proper care they will last a long time. Happy to say that I have used the baking sheets to make several dozen cookies, and they turned out perfect. I would recommend this set.

I recieved and have been using my new Rachael Ray 10-piece Cucina bakeware for about a month now and I LOVE LOVE LOVE them so far!!! They arrived very quickly, were packaged neatly, arrived scratch free, and are a beautiful color. The metal is very thick - much more sturdy than any other pans/cookie sheets I have ever owned. I love that all of the pans have a good size handle area on both sides - I used to hate picking up my cake pan or muffin tins and having the thumb of my oven mitt smoosh into the food when I was trying to remove it from a hot oven. The handles are a perfect size to pick up with my gloved hand. I have also noticed the red silicone parts are thick enough that it helps keep the pans from scratching each other when they are stored (I don't know if that is their purpose or not, but they work).I decided to write this review now because I accidently tested out the non-stick surface last night. I made a spiral glazed ham for the first time ever. I wrapped the ham in foil as it said to do on the package, however I was afraid the juices would leak all over my oven, and I would have trouble lifting an odd shaped, really hot ham. I decided to put one of the cookie sheets under the foil wrapped ham. I baked it for a little over 2 hours, removed it, opened the foil, poured on the sticky glaze, re-wrapped it as best as I could, and popped it back in the oven. As the ham finished cooking, the glaze got WAY more sticky, and leaked out of the foil, all over the cookie pan, bubbled up, and literally burnt onto the surface. {I wish I had taken a picture of it to show how terrible it looked} I thought to myself "Oh crap, I just totally ruined my brand new, kind of expensive pan". After removing the delicious ham, I debated on whether I was going to try to clean the pan, or just mark it up as a loss and throw it away. I ran hot water over it just to see if there was any hope, and to my literal amazement, the burnt goo began falling off and rinsing out! There were a couple of spots that the water didn't seem to work on, so I put a couple of drops of Dawn in the pan, filled it with hot water, and let it sit overnight. I just rinsed the pan with more hot water, and before I even touched it with the sponge, the rest of the burnt goo fell out!! The pan looks brand new, like it had never gone through such a horrible ordeal :-) I have never had a pan that came clean without severe scrubbing, scraping, soaking, and more scrubbing. This one literally rinsed clean without me even touching it with a sponge (I of course did wipe a soft soapy sponge over it to ensure it was thoroughly clean, but I probably didn't have to)BEST PANS EVER!!!
